Anyway, the biggest selling "pop" artists (reputedly) according to Wikipedia:
(edited out what I think are not pop)

> 500m records sold
1 The Beatles
2 Michael Jackson
200m - 499m records sold
3 ABBA
4 Celine Dion
5 Cher
6 Cliff Richard
7 Elton John
8 Madonna
9 Rod Stewart
10 The Rolling Stones

In the 100m-199m sold list we get the likes of Backstreet Boys, Bee-Gees, Billy Joel, Bon Jovi, The Carpenters, Chicago, Dire Straits, Eagles, Fleetwood Mac, Genesis, George Michael, Prince, Queen, U2, Village People
